Human Rights Watch Sunday called on Indonesia to drop treason charges against five peaceful protesters, a day ahead of their expected trial in the remote province of Papua.
2012-01-29
Human Rights Watch Sunday called on Indonesia to drop treason charges against five peaceful protesters, a day ahead of their expected trial in the remote province of Papua.